Center to Sell Off Air India’s Realty Assets to Recover ₹90 bn
The government is looking to sell off land and reality assets of debt-ridden Air India for around ₹90 billion. This will help it lower the current debt of ₹550 billion and fetch a good valuation if and when the government decides to sell the domestic air carrier.

An official said that the Centre will sell property assets including Airlines House in Mumbai, land at Baba Kharak Singh mark and realty property in Vasant Vihar in Delhi.
